Dimethyl Disulfide (DMDS): Bulk Supply, Application, and Global Market Dynamics

Navigating the Supply and Purchase of DMDS

In my experience working with industrial chemicals, securing dimethyl disulfide (DMDS) is rarely a one-click purchase. Buyers, whether distributors or end-users, weigh every part of the procurement process—MOQs, quotes, and certification become as important as the product’s purity. Most inquiries begin with bulk or wholesale needs, since DMDS finds use in refineries as a sulfiding agent, in agrochemicals, and specialty synthesis. Suppliers often list both CIF and FOB options—it makes sense, since shipping requirements for hazardous goods can complicate logistics. Distributors look for quotes covering both spot market and contract supply, with terms that favor flexibility as annual demand changes.

Price remains tied to global sulfur and methanol feedstock dynamics. Some buyers try to negotiate special terms for recurring orders or OEM projects. Each purchase order triggers a back-and-forth over quality assurance—industry asks for COA, ISO certifications, and compliance with REACH, FDA, and even Halal and Kosher standards if the application touches food contact. Distributors with a track record for SGS inspection or third-party testing do inspire more trust. Quality certification feels less like red tape and more like a baseline after reading news stories about contaminated supply runs.

Markets, Demand, and Trends Shaping DMDS Distribution

Global demand paints a patchwork. Refineries across Asia and the Middle East buy in the largest quantities because of ongoing hydrotreating and catalyst sulfiding projects. Other regions depend on seasonal factors—the agricultural sector’s use of DMDS in soil fumigation spikes ahead of planting. Policy changes and new regulatory scrutiny on sulfur compounds shift demand overnight. I’ve seen distributors responding with market reports highlighting shifts caused by new REACH submissions, supply bottlenecks from logistics slowdowns, or volatility in upstream costs, like high natural gas prices. Buyers keeping an eye on news can catch early warnings before prices climb. Inquiry rates for bulk supply or samples trend higher after major policy updates or after media coverage of DMDS’s role in green energy processes.

Demand for DMDS isn’t just about volume. Some end-users want niche grades—halal-kosher-certified for their customers, or FDA-compliant for certain plastics. Tighter environmental policy in Europe and the US pushes the need for meticulous documentation: up-to-date SDS, TDS, and full REACH dossiers. It isn’t enough to offer a quality product—suppliers keep fielding requests for custom COA formats, product traceability down to the batch number, and even open inspections by SGS. Every inquiry feels more like an audit than a sales call, especially as buyers learn from previous supply chain headaches.

Barriers to Entry and the Need for Quality Certification

Policy hurdles stack up. If a factory needs to qualify a new batch, it often asks for a free sample, but I’ve learned from purchasing teams that testing costs and paperwork can stall a project for weeks. Larger distributors respond faster because they store DMDS in ISO-certified warehouses and ship with proper SGS declarations—delays mean lost business. Small-scale buyers, hoping to try a lower MOQ, often run into minimum volume barriers or struggle to compare quotes transparently. The lack of standardization in DMDS quotes—some in metric tons CIF, others FOB per drum—creates confusion that favors only those with the experience to navigate the maze.

In recent years, buyers have become more conscious of traceability and product origin. Quality certifications like ISO, Halal, and Kosher become selling points rather than checkboxes under pressure from downstream audits. Market reports highlight a growing rate of bulk purchase linked to companies with robust certification portfolios. Some buyers insist on SGS or other third-party inspection to guard against supply quality swings. In my professional network, I’ve seen a few buyers blacklist vendors over a single lapse in GMP, COA inaccuracy, or failure to meet updated REACH registration. DMDS may be a specialty chemical, but the handling matches anything in the broader fine chemicals or ingredient market.

Application, Use, and Real-World Challenges

DMDS doesn’t sit in a warehouse for long. Major uses range from petrochemical catalyst sulfiding, fumigation in high-value agriculture, polymer modification, and even electronics. Applications are diversified but each requires careful handling—DMDS has a pungent odor, requiring sealed drums, accurate labeling, and robust SDS documentation for both OEM and open-market orders. Sales teams see the effect of this reality in weekly inquiries on application guides, use cases, and regulatory Q&A. Compliance requests crowd procurement emails: REACH certificates for EU-bound drums, FDA for any contact substance in American supply chains, and custom reports for OEM clients developing new materials. As policies tighten, I’ve watched the application support side surge—a new product launch sometimes depends more on securing approvals than on technical performance itself.

Markets evolve quickly. Industry news reports a steady uptick in demand each year, even as regulatory barriers mount. Bulk purchasers continue to center their search around suppliers showing a clean track record with ISO, SGS, and Halal-Kosher certifications. Buyers want product ready for surprise audits, packaged for efficiency in both warehouse and transport. Leading suppliers adopt updates to SDS, TDS, and documentation in lockstep with new laws. The end goal—whether in refining, agriculture, or advanced materials—relies less on low price and more on proven compliance and supplier reliability.
